    Had to stop and think for a moment, since we have had a few "mice situations".

    • Had several inside our travel trailer
    • The one in my Tacoma air ducts
    • Several in our house
    And yes, I did get the issue in my truck resolved. I found the dead mouse who got stuck in the air intake area, somehow. Got his head wedged between twp hard plastic panels and died when he couldn't get loose. My truck actually had a plastic grate over the air intake portal from the factory, but he apparently shewed through it. I replaced with a section of hard steel rain gutter leaf guard, as suggested in a thread here on TW.

    This is what I found when I took things apart.
